Notice from the Court of Appeal: New Court Rules
New Court of Appeal of Appeal rules (for civil and criminal appeals) come into force on September 4, 2025. They were published in the Newfoundland and Labrador Gazette on June 6, 2025 and come into force 90 days later.
Proceedings commenced, but not completed, prior to the coming into force of the new rules shall be governed by the new rules without prejudice to anything lawfully done under the former rules.
Any documents filed prior to September 4, 2025, which are in compliance with the current rules, are sufficient and do not need to be re-filed. Any documents filed on September 4, 2025 or later should be in compliance with the new rules.
